About Mountain Orthotic & Prosthetic Services
Mountain Orthotic and Prosthetic Services is a full service orthotic and prosthetic practice serving the Adirondack North Country. We offer custom and pre-fabricated orthoses, select Durable Medical Equipment, and personalized prosthetic care. Our family owned and operated practice offers a friendly welcoming environment for patients of all ages.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Syracuse?

Understanding the cost of living near Syracuse is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Mountain Orthotic & Prosthetic Services.
Syracuse's Cost of Living Index is approximately 80.7 (19.3% less expensive than US average; 35.5% less than NY average). Central NY city (Syracuse Univ.), affordable housing, snow. Centro bus.
